Lexicon :: Strong's G143 - aisthanomai

Choose a new font size and typeface
αἰσθάνομαι
Transliteration
aisthanomai (Key)
Pronunciation
ahee-sthan'-om-ahee
Listen
Part of Speech
verb
Root Word (Etymology)
Of uncertain derivation
Dictionary Aids

Vine's Expository Dictionary: View Entry

TDNT Reference: 1:187,29

Strong’s Definitions

αἰσθάνομαι aisthánomai, ahee-sthan'-om-ahee; of uncertain derivation; to apprehend (properly, by the senses):—perceive.


KJV Translation Count — Total: 1x

The KJV translates Strong's G143 in the following manner: perceive (1x).

STRONGS G143:
αἰσθάνομαι: 2 aorist ᾐσθόμην; [from Aeschylus down]; deponent middle to perceive;
1. by the bodily senses;
2. with the mind; to understand: Luke 9:45.
